Subject: Welcome to the Vigilum on-call rotation

Hi, and welcome aboard. As the on-call engineer for the Vigilum proctoring queue, your main responsibility is watching for exam sessions stuck in the "review pending" state for more than fifteen minutes. These usually clear on their own, but if the backlog exceeds two hundred sessions, you'll need to manually drain the queue and notify the academic integrity team via the escalation channel. Before your first shift, please read the full on-call guide carefully, which is posted here.

runbook for tajep-yahig: https://artifactory.lumictech.corp/repo

**Finance Review — Board Summary**

Quick update on winding down the Lumabrick product line. Revenue has been sliding for six quarters, and margins are now below our floor. Retiring it frees up roughly a fifth of the Kelvane plant's capacity and lets Marisol's team refocus on the Corvessa range. One-off costs land mostly in Q2; we'll recover them within eighteen months. The board should note what comes next before we brief wider staff.

confidential, kagup-bafog: Fraaxax Group is in early talks to buy Soroxox Group for about $343.8 million. The Olidor launch date is June 14, and nothing goes to the press before then. Legal wants the Aldmirek Logistics term sheet signed before July 23.

**Action Item PM-207:** Incremental rebuilds in Stonepress skipped pages whose only change was a shared template, shipping stale pricing copy for six hours. Fix: track template dependencies in the rebuild graph and add a nightly full-rebuild safety net. Owner: Edda. Due: Q3. Maintainers should read the dependency-graph design before touching the cache. Details are on the internal page here.

runbook for badug-kadup: https://confluence.zemvarlabs.internal/projects/browse/display/projects/bd1b

**Ticket: Config drift on Mailwright bounce processor**

For the weekly sync: the bounce processor in the Tallow environment has drifted from the committed baseline. Retry intervals and the suppression-list TTL were changed manually during the October incident and never backported, so redeploys keep reverting behavior and bounce classification differs between regions. Proposal: adopt the live values as the new baseline and commit them. The values currently running in Tallow are listed below.

settings of yahag-yafog:
[pramir]
host = pramir.qirvancorp.internal
user = pramir_svc
database = pramir_prod